From 28efc50a04b0a5eccfde1bf6d62a26f8d3d4e04e Mon Sep 17 00:00:00 2001 From: Connor McLaughlin Date: Sat, 11 Jan 2020 14:21:08 +1000 Subject: [PATCH] Qt: Fix worker thread lockup on shutdown --- src/duckstation-qt/qthostinterface.cpp | 1 + 1 file changed, 1 insertion(+) diff --git a/src/duckstation-qt/qthostinterface.cpp b/src/duckstation-qt/qthostinterface.cpp index c387c82e4..9ce6e65ba 100644 --- a/src/duckstation-qt/qthostinterface.cpp +++ b/src/duckstation-qt/qthostinterface.cpp @@ -487,6 +487,7 @@ void QtHostInterface::stopThread() void QtHostInterface::doStopThread() { m_shutdown_flag.store(true); + m_worker_thread_event_loop->quit(); } void QtHostInterface::threadEntryPoint()